Brief Biodata

Debbie Ong teaches Family Law, Law & Sociology of the Family and the Law of Torts at the NUS Faculty of Law and publishes mainly in the area of family law. She has served as a Court Mediator in the Family Court for a decade and currently serves as Vice-Chairperson of the Law Society's Family Law Practice Committee. She is also a member of the International Advisory Board of the Child & Family Law Quarterly journal. Debbie enjoys being involved in projects which further the development of a good family justice system. Believing in the need for community support for families in Singapore, she has also been chairing the Centre Governance Board of the Tampines Family Service Centre for a number of years and is presently on the Advisory Board of 'Marriage Central'.
